Our review of the ORACAL 951 Dove Blue 549 Premium Cast Film finds it best suited to crafters and sign makers who need a durable, color-stable cast vinyl for long-term outdoor and indoor graphics. The single biggest reason to buy is the ORACAL 951 formulation itself: a premium cast film developed for sign industry use that balances ease of cutting and transfer with up to 10 year outdoor durability. This review focuses on real-world use in plotters like Cricut and Silhouette, noting installation guidance and practical handling traits.
Key Features
- Premium cast vinyl: Provides superior longevity and stability for permanent signage and graphics compared with typical calendared film.
- Plotter friendly: Cuts cleanly in Cricut, Silhouette, Roland and Graphtec machines for precise shapes and lettering.
- Up to 10 year outdoor durability: Formulated to resist weathering so graphics remain intact longer on permanent applications.
- Dry or wet application: Allows flexibility during installation so users can choose the method that suits their surface and skill level.
- Intermediate 2.0 mil thickness: Designed for easier transferring which helps with accurate placement and fewer distortions.
- Installation guide included: Rvinyl Quick Guide flyer helps with proper surface prep and application steps for better results.
Who It's For
This vinyl is aimed at hobbyists, crafters and small sign shops that use plotter cutters and need a long-lasting cast film for decals, vehicle graphics and outdoor signage. People who value a proven sign industry material will appreciate the durability and cut performance of ORACAL 951.
It is less suitable for shoppers who require extremely crease-resistant handling during aggressive repositioning, as some customers noted limitations with crease resistance. If you need very low-cost short-term vinyl for temporary craft projects, a less specialized calendared film may be a better fit.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use this with a Cricut or Silhouette?
Yes. The film is designed for plotter cutters including Cricut, Silhouette, Roland and Graphtec machines and cuts cleanly in these devices.
How long will the film last outdoors?
ORACAL 951 is rated for up to 10 year outdoor durability when applied correctly and on suitable surfaces.
Is the film easy to apply?
Yes. It supports dry or wet application methods and includes a Rvinyl Quick Guide to assist with installation; however, careful handling is advised to avoid creases.
